If you're a hot dog lover in Houston's University Place neighborhood, there are plenty of options to choose from. But which joints are the best? We scoured the internet for reviews and comments from locals and tourists alike to bring you the top hot dog spots in University Place.
One highly recommended spot is Good Dog Houston, located on West Alabama Street. Their all-beef hot dogs come with creative toppings such as bacon jam, roasted garlic aioli, and truffle mayo. Prices range from $7 to $11 per hot dog, making it a bit pricier than some other options but worth the splurge according to many reviewers.
Another popular choice among locals is The Hot Dog Shoppe, located on Richmond Avenue. It's been a University Place staple for over 40 years, serving up classic hot dogs, chili dogs, and even breakfast dogs. Prices here are more affordable, averaging around $4 per hot dog.
For a unique twist on a classic favorite, check out Happy Fatz on South Shepherd Drive. They offer a variety of hot dog options such as their "Piggy Mac" topped with macaroni and cheese and pulled pork. Prices range from $6 to $9 per hot dog.
As far as where locals go versus tourists, it seems like Good Dog Houston is popular among both groups while The Hot Dog Shoppe tends to attract more locals. Happy Fatz seems to have a mix of both locals and tourists.
Overall, if you're looking for a delicious hot dog in University Place, you can't go wrong with any of these three spots. From classic to creative toppings, there's something for every hot dog lover in this neighborhood.
